Role SummaryOwns and manages the training and development program for the Modern Work & Citizen AI portfolio — spanning Microsoft Office 365, Copilot, Power Platform, SharePoint, and broader modern-workspace skilling. A well-seasoned senior individual contributor who operates independently against defined goals and collaborates closely with the existing training specialist, communications, HR, the enablement team, and external learning vendors. The scope covers the full modern workspace, not AI alone.Key ResponsibilitiesCourse & program design — Design and develop end-to-end learning paths and courses for Modern Work and Citizen AI enablement (Microsoft Office 365, Copilot, Power Platform, SharePoint, and related modern-workspace skills); incorporate appropriate methodologies, assessments, and multi-channel delivery across internal and vendor platforms; and develop high-quality content that drives engagement and measurable capability growth.Delivery & impact evaluation — Coordinate and deliver training programs across regions and vendor cohorts; guide and advise learners; and evaluate not just completion but downstream impact — following up with participants to assess what changed in their day-to-day work and feeding those insights back into program design.Stakeholder engagement & gap analysis — Engage business-area leaders and HR partners to clarify enablement priorities; gather data on current AI and modern-work competency and adoption; identify capability gaps against target levels; and secure agreement on goals and outcomes for each intervention.Tooling configuration & process — Configure and maintain the learning tooling that supports these paths — working with HR to set up systems such as JDU/Compass, and with the landing-zone team to build and enable learning paths as they are created — and establish and monitor the operating procedures behind program rollout.Program collateral & communications — Partner with the communications lead and design/brand resources to produce program collateral, drive awareness of available programs, and publish enablement content on-brand.Vendor relationship & queries — Serve as the day-to-day point of contact for external training vendors — owning the relationship and cohort scheduling week to week — and field the growing volume of organic enablement questions from across the organization, escalating where interpretation or a decision is needed.Adoption data & insights — Analyze participation data — who is participating in which programs by region, and program effectiveness — to surface trends and provide targeted feedback to stakeholders on where to focus communication and enablement effort.Platform & vendor evaluation — Evaluate the learning-platform and vendor landscape (e.g., Pluralsight, Microsoft Learn, Changing Social, and others), weigh drawbacks and fit, and form a clear recommendation on what best suits our needs; design and apply assessments to measure learner competency and progression along each path.Self-development & staying current — Develop own capabilities through ongoing training, coaching, and relevant accreditation; and stay current on Microsoft 365, Copilot, agent/AI capabilities, and modern-work learning best practices through continuous education and industry media to keep the enablement approach ahead of the curve.Ideal Candidate ProfileIndependent operator. Comfortable owning a program end to end against defined goals with minimal oversight, while collaborating with an existing training specialist.Learning-path & curriculum design. Background building learning paths and curricula, with a clear point of view on how assessments are best used to measure progression.Opinionated platform evaluator. Able to weigh competing learning platforms and vendors and recommend the best fit for the organization, with reasoning.Outcome- and impact-focused. Measures behavior change and business impact after training, not just course completion.Communications- and adoption-minded. Knows how to drive awareness and uptake of programs across a large, multi-region organization.Core CompetenciesCommunicates effectively — delivers multi-mode communications tuned to different audiences.Manages complexity — makes sense of high-volume, sometimes contradictory information to solve problems.Ensures accountability — holds self and others accountable to commitments.Collaborates — builds partnerships to meet shared objectives.Drives engagement — creates a climate that motivates people to do their best.Optimizes work processes — focuses on the most effective processes and continuous improvement.Key Skills & ExperienceSkills & knowledgeLearning & talent development, and LMS / e-learning / computer-based trainingInstructional design, curriculum development, and assessment designData collection and analysis — turning adoption and participation data into decisionsPlanning, organizing, and prioritizing across multiple concurrent programsVendor and stakeholder managementContent creation and presentation (written, visual, video, and web) and strong verbal communicationComfort with Microsoft 365 and Copilot; familiarity with AI/agent enablement is a strong plusEducation & experienceBachelor's degree or equivalentOver 3 to 6 years of relevant experience — able to handle most situations independently and advise othersSome experience coordinating the work of others
